About Faouziya Haissen
Faouziya Haissen is a scholar working on Geophysics, Earth-Surface Processes and Geology, having authored 34 papers that have together received 518 indexed citations. Recurring topics across this work include Geological and Geophysical Studies Worldwide (32 papers), Geological and Geochemical Analysis (27 papers) and earthquake and tectonic studies (25 papers). The work is most often cited by research in Geophysics (466 citations), Geochemistry and Petrology (34 citations) and Geology (16 citations). Faouziya Haissen has collaborated with scholars based in Morocco, Spain and France. Frequent co-authors include Ф. Беа, P. Montero, J.F. Molina, Abdelkrim El Archi, Antonio García‐Casco, Abdellah Mouttaqi, Dominique Frizon de Lamotte, Geoffroy Mohn, E. Rjimati and R. L. Torres‐Roldán. Their work appears in journals such as SHILAP Revista de lepidopterología, Earth-Science Reviews and Journal of Petrology.
